FAQ
How much does a roofing repair typically cost in Peoria, Illinois?
The cost varies based on materials, labor, and the extent of the damage. On average, repair jobs may range from a few hundred to over a thousand dollars, but getting multiple quotes can help you find a fair price.
Can I repair a leaking roof myself, or should I hire a professional in Peoria?
Minor leaks can sometimes be patched temporarily, but for lasting results and to avoid further damage, it's best to hire a qualified roofing contractor. Professionals can spot underlying issues and ensure safe, effective repairs.
What should I look for in a roofing contractor in Peoria, Illinois?
Look for licensed, insured contractors with good reviews and local experience. Ask for written estimates, check references, and ensure they offer warranties on their work.
Will my homeowners insurance cover roof repairs in Peoria?
Insurance coverage depends on your policy and the cause of the damage. Sudden perils like storms are typically covered, but wear and tear is not. Review your policy and consult with your provider.
